Why Setting Industry Standards Through Promotional Campaigns Is Essential for B2B Ruby on Rails Companies
Establishing industry standards means positioning your company’s solutions, processes, or products as the benchmark within the Ruby on Rails community. For B2B Rails development companies, this translates to making your methodologies, frameworks, and service quality the preferred choice for clients and partners.
The Business Impact of Standard-Setting Promotion
- Differentiation: Stand out in a crowded market by becoming the recognized standard-bearer.
- Trust and Credibility: Industry standards signal reliability, attracting enterprise clients and fostering long-term partnerships.
- Market Influence: Shape Rails development trends, tools, and best practices.
- Client Loyalty: Clients aligned with your standards engage more deeply and renew contracts.
- Pricing Power: Command premium pricing based on recognized expertise and standards.
Without proactive promotion, your company risks blending in as just another Rails provider rather than leading the market.
Understanding Standard-Setting Promotion in Ruby on Rails Development
Standard-setting promotion is a strategic marketing approach focused on positioning your company’s products, services, or methodologies as the accepted industry norm or best practice. This involves educating stakeholders, influencing decision-makers, and consistently demonstrating leadership that others want to emulate.
In the Rails context, this could mean advocating for your proprietary coding standards, deployment pipelines, or security protocols as the ‘gold standard’ for enterprise-grade Rails applications.
Mini-definition:
Standard-setting promotion — marketing efforts aimed at establishing a company’s practices or products as industry benchmarks.

How to Implement Each Strategy for Maximum Impact
1. Develop and Publish Proprietary Frameworks and Best Practices
- Identify recurring challenges your team uniquely solves.
- Document your approach with code snippets, architecture diagrams, and workflows.
- Publish these on platforms like GitHub or your company website.
- Promote through Rails forums, developer communities, and newsletters.
Example: Basecamp’s promotion of the "Convention over Configuration" principle became a foundational Rails standard.

7. Invest in Automated Quality and Compliance Tools
- Integrate tools like static code analyzers and CI/CD pipelines (e.g., CircleCI, CodeClimate) to enforce coding standards automatically.
- Provide clients with dashboards to monitor compliance and quality metrics.
- Customize tools to fit client environments through consulting services.
- Highlight these tools in promotional campaigns to demonstrate your commitment to quality and innovation.
Real-World Examples of Effective Standard-Setting Promotion
Company | Standard-Setting Initiative | Industry Impact |
---|---|---|
Shopify | Developed proprietary Rails extensions like Active Merchant | Set payment processing standards widely adopted |
GitHub | Implemented rigorous code review and deployment standards | Became benchmarks in the Rails community |
Basecamp | Promoted "Getting Real" methodology and Rails conventions | Influenced Rails development culture globally |
These examples illustrate how leading Rails companies have successfully positioned their standards to influence the broader ecosystem.
Measuring the Success of Your Standard-Setting Strategies
Strategy | Key Metrics | Measurement Tools and Methods |
---|---|---|
Proprietary Frameworks | Downloads, forks, citations | GitHub analytics, web traffic reports |
Thought Leadership Content | Engagement rate, leads generated | Google Analytics, social media metrics |
Industry Collaboration | Speaking engagements, memberships | Event records, participation logs |
Customer Feedback Validation | NPS score, satisfaction ratings | Survey analytics from platforms like Zigpoll, interviews |
Certification Programs | Number of certifications completed | LMS platform reports |
Success Stories | Conversion rate uplift, retention | CRM data, client feedback |
Automated Tools | Compliance rate, bug reduction | CI/CD reports, QA dashboards |
Tracking these metrics helps you quantify the impact of your promotional efforts and adjust strategies accordingly.
